Although at first glance this looks like a "CHECK MY CIVIC yO!" topic that doesn;t belong here, the truth is I would like to make a point about the 92+ Civics and this has nothing to do with appearance so I believe this is the right place to post this.

Ode to the 92-95 EG HBs

I have had a few EGs. Sold them all. All white. Last night I went to the store to buy some groceries and I picked up the local trader paper where people can list their stuff for sale for free.
There was on ad that got my attention:

"92 Civic for sale. Needs work. call ........."

So I called last night and left a message. Told the guy to call me till 11:00 PM last night... So he did. Told me that the car doesn;t run, needs work and that the body is fine and that it is a DX , white....

So this morning, I go to look at it, 1 hour ago. I get there, look at it, check out the engine bay... Car looked clean, no rust in any of the panels... I was suprised. So he gives me the keys and I start it.

Me- I htough you said it doesn't run?
Him- well it does, but makes this noise (points to valve cover, knocking noise)
Me- Yes, I can hear that. It will need some work, but I am willing to do it.
How about $450?

Him- You got a deal.

I got the title and bailed before he called the cops, reporting the car stolen


Point of my story.... Forget what you know about these cars. Forget the gsr swaps, the beauty of their body, the great gas mileage.....

They are just like any other POS 10 year old cars out there... NOT!!!
